Webverkeer is een fascinerend onderwerp, en het lezen van IP-headers kan je inzicht geven in wat er zich achter de schermen afspeelt. In dit artikel duiken we diep in de wereld van IP-headers, VPN’s en alles wat daarbij komt kijken. Je leert niet alleen wat een IP-header is, maar ook hoe je deze kunt interpreteren om je netwerkverkeer beter te begrijpen. En geloof me, dat is nuttiger dan je denkt!
Wat is een IP-header?
Wat is een IP-adres?
Een IP-adres is als jouw huisnummer op internet. Het is de unieke identificatie die jouw apparaat helpt om gegevens te verzenden en ontvangen. Wanneer je een website bezoekt, wordt er een verzoek gestuurd naar het IP-adres van die website. Simpel zat, toch? Maar wat zit er eigenlijk achter die cijfers?
Voorbeeld van een IP-adres:
- 192.168.1.1 (dit is een typisch privé IP-adres)
- 216.58.214.14 (een publiek IP-adres van Google)
Wat maakt een IP-header zo belangrijk?
De IP-header is als de envelop van een brief. Hij bevat cruciale informatie die elk datapakket nodig heeft om zijn bestemming te bereiken. Dit omvat onder andere het IP-adres van de afzender, het IP-adres van de ontvanger, en verschillende andere gegevens die van belang zijn voor de routering van de gegevens.
| Element | Beschrijving |
|---|---|
| Versie | Geeft de versie van het IP-protocol aan |
| Headerlengte | Lengte van de header in 32-bits woorden |
| Type of service | Kwaliteit van de dienstverlening |
| Totale lengte | Totale lengte van het IP-pakket in bytes |
| Identificatie | Voor het fragmenteren en assembleren |
| Time to live (TTL) | Hoe lang het pakket ‘levend’ mag blijven |
| Protocol | Het protocol dat wordt gebruikt (TCP, UDP) |
Een kijkje in de structuur
Lees ook: IP-adres delen met anderen: welke risico’s zijn reëel?
Laten we het type van IP-header eens nader bekijken. Er zijn twee hoofdcategorieën: IPv4 en IPv6. IPv4 is de meest bekende – je ziet die getallenreeks vaak. IPv6 is als de luxe versie, ontworpen om de groeiende vraag naar internetadressen te kunnen bijbenen. Denk eraan, met de stijgende populariteit van het internet, is IPv4 als een café dat vol zit – je kunt moeilijk een plek vinden!
IP-header ontleden
De basiscomponenten
Wanneer je een IP-header onder de loep neemt, zie je enkele belangrijke onderdelen. Laten we ze snel doornemen:
- Versie: Dit vertelt je of je met IPv4 of IPv6 te maken hebt. Meestal is het IPv4, maar wie weet vind je een kleurrijke IPv6-header in de wild.
- Headerlengte: Dit is vrij technisch, maar het geeft aan hoe groot je header is. Nu weet je dat elk detail telt!
- Totale lengte: Dit vertelt je hoe groot het hele pakket is. Het is net een goede pizzadoo: groter is altijd beter, als je maar genoeg kunt eten.
- Protocol: Dit vertelt welk type transportprotocol wordt gebruikt. Dit kan TCP of UDP zijn; elk heeft zijn eigen kenmerken. Onthoud dit – het kan een groot verschil maken!
Fragmentatie en assemblage
IP-headers zijn ontworpen met fragmentatie in gedachten. Dit betekent dat als de gegevens te groot zijn om in één keer te verzenden, ze in kleinere stukken worden geknipt. Elk van deze fragmenten krijgt zijn eigen IP-header, zodat de ontvanger ze kan verzamelen en weer samenvoegen. Als je denkt dat puzzels moeilijk zijn, probeer dan maar eens een netwerkpakket!
Hoe werkt dat?
- Stel je voor dat je een video van 1 GB online wilt streamen. Het wordt in kleine stukjes van 256 KB verzonden. Elke header zorgt ervoor dat de server en jouw apparaat precies weten hoe ze die stukjes bij elkaar moeten krijgen.
VPN en IP-headers
Wat is een VPN?
Een Virtual Private Network, of VPN, is als een geheime tunnel die je persoonsgegevens beschermt wanneer je online bent. Het versleutelt jouw internetverkeer, zodat niemand kan meelezen. Dit is vooral handig als je je op het openbare wifi-netwerk van je favoriete koffietentje bevindt – beter veilig dan sorry!
Hoe beïnvloedt een VPN IP-headers?
Wanneer je een VPN gebruikt, verandert je IP-adres in dat van de VPN-server. Hierdoor ziet de website die je bezoekt het IP-adres van de VPN en niet dat van jou. Dit is uitstekend voor je privacy, maar het kan ook leiden tot wat vertraging. Als je dacht dat je internetverbinding soms traag was, wacht maar tot je een VPN aanschakelt!
VPN-protocollen en hun impact
Verschillende VPN-protocollen hebben verschillende manieren om IP-headers te manipuleren. Hier zijn de meest gangbare:
- OpenVPN: Zeer veilig en flexibel. Het houdt je verkeersinformatie goed afgesloten.
- L2TP/IPSec: Iets minder snel, maar heel veilig. Dit is als de perfecte combinatie van gezelligheid en veiligheid bij een koffiebar.
- IKEv2/IPSec: Topprestaties, vooral op mobiele apparaten. Dacht je dat je altijd bereikbaar moest zijn? Met IKEv2 ben je dat ook.
IP-headers bij netwerkbeveiliging
Hoe kunnen we IP-headers gebruiken voor beveiliging?
IP-headers kunnen je meer vertellen dan je denkt. Ze kunnen helpen bij het detecteren van verdachte activiteiten. Met tools zoals Wireshark kun je IP-headers analyseren om ongebruikelijke patronen te herkennen. Het is net als een detective die bewijs verzamelt!
Hoe zie je verdachte headers?
Hier zijn enkele tekenen dat iets niet in de haak is:
- Onbekende IP-adressen: Als je verzoeken van IP-adressen ziet die je niet herkent, wees dan op je hoede.
- Ongebruikelijk hoog dataverkeer: Een plotselinge toename in verkeer kan duiden op een aanval.
- Ongepaste pakketfragmenten: Fragmenten die niet overeenkomen met de verwachte lengtes, kunnen duiden op kwaadwillende activiteit.
Tools voor het analyseren van IP-headers
Wanneer je IP-headers gaat analyseren, zijn er verschillende tools die je kunt gebruiken:
- Wireshark: Een veelgebruikte tool voor netwerkprotocollen. Het decoderen van IP-headers wordt een fluitje van een cent.
- tcpdump: Perfect voor command line geeks. Het laat je IP-headers in stijl analyseren.
- Fiddler: Ideal voor webverkeer. Het laat je niet alleen de headers zien, maar ook de inhoud van de aanvragen.
Het belang van IPv6
Waarom IPv6?
Met de explosieve groei van het internet lopen we tegen de grenzen van IPv4 aan. We hebben een oplossing nodig, en dat is net waar IPv6 om de hoek komt kijken. Het biedt een bijna eindeloos aantal IP-adressen. Dit is als de opslagruimte in je huis – je hebt nooit genoeg als je steeds meer spullen koopt!
Wat zit er in de IPv6-header?
De structuur van een IPv6-header is iets anders dan die van IPv4. Hier zijn de belangrijkste elementen:
| Element | Beschrijving |
|---|---|
| Versie | Altijd 6 voor IPv6 |
| Traffic Class | Voor kwaliteitsdiensten |
| Flow Label | Vergelijkbaar met TCP-verbindingen |
| Payload Length | De grootte van de gegevensgrootte |
| Next Header | Geeft het type protocol aan |
| Hop Limit | Vergelijkbaar met TTL in IPv4 |
| Bron- en bestemmingsadres | Elke met 128 bits (voor IPv6) |
De toekomst van netwerken
IPv6 is essentieel voor de toekomst van internet. Met apparaten die elk jaar het internet opgaan, is de noodzaak voor IPv6 cruciaal. Je zou kunnen zeggen dat IPv6 de plannenmaker is voor de ondergang van IPv4. Vergeet niet dat deze verandering niet van de ene op de andere dag zal komen, maar langzaam maar zeker.
IP-headers in actie
Zien hoe het werkt in de praktijk
Een goed voorbeeld van het belang van IP-headers kun je zien tijdens een cyberaanval. Stel je voor, een hacker probeert toegang te krijgen tot een bedrijfsnetwerk. Dankzij de gegevens die in de IP-headers zijn opgeslagen, kan het netwerkverdedigingsteam het kwaadaardige IP adres identificeren en blokkeren.
- Statistiek: Meer dan 70% van de bedrijven die slachtoffer worden van een DDoS-aanval, heeft geen gedegen monitoring van hun IP-headers.
Verbeter je netwerkbeheer
Als je IP-headers goed kunt lezen en interpreteren, heb je een voorsprong in netwerkbeheer. Je kunt trends en patronen herkennen die je kunnen helpen bij het optimaliseren van prestaties en de beveiliging van je netwerk. Dit bespaart tijd, geld en frustratie.
Leer van je netwerkverkeer
Door regelmatig je IP-headers te analyseren, kun je proactief reageren op problemen voordat ze zich voordoen. In dat geval ben je meer een timmerman met je gereedschap dan een brandweerman die branden moet blussen. En laten we eerlijk zijn, het is altijd leuker om nieuwe dingen te maken dan alleen maar problemen op te lossen!
Veelgestelde vragen
1. Wat is het verschil tussen IPv4 en IPv6?
IPv4 is een 32-bits adres en ondersteunt ongeveer 4 miljard adressen. IPv6, aan de andere kant, is 128-bits en biedt een vrijwel onbeperkt aantal adressen. Dit maakt IPv6 essentieel voor de toekomst van internet!
2. Hoe kan ik mijn IP-adres verbergen?
Je kunt je IP-adres verbergen met behulp van een VPN. Deze creëert een versleutelde verbinding die je verkeer door een andere server leidt, waardoor je echte IP-adres wordt verborgen.
3. Waarom zijn IP-headers belangrijk voor netwerkbeveiliging?
IP-headers zorgen voor cruciale informatie die je helpt bij het detecteren van verdachte activiteiten en het beschermen van je netwerk. Door IP-headers te analyseren, kun je potentiële bedreigingen identificeren voordat ze kwaad kunnen.
4. Kan ik IP-headers zelf analyseren?
Ja, met tools zoals Wireshark of tcpdump kun je IP-headers analyseren. Dit stelt je in staat om een beter inzicht te krijgen in het verkeer dat door je netwerk stroomt en om beveiligingsproblemen te identificeren.